Nau mai haere mai ki ta matou whanau |Welcome to our Fulton Hogan Family As a Site Engineer you will assist the Manager in site set ups, planning, quality control and pulling together resources to complete projects.
You will put your efficient manner, and high level of skill and productively to use in order to complete projects on time and on budget.
In addition to the above you will: Conduct site investigations and field testing of various infrastructure failureInterpret contract documentation, building codes, regulations and industry standards into a work instruction to communicate to crews to allow them to build itProvide support to senior civil engineers in the construction, management and design of a variety of projectsGood Work equals Good BenefitsMedical insurance for you and your whanau.
